Transaction 75faab102aaa4e6f77ac3f9840d8684fd08c003a85e52ac999a9f34230f2b0db
1 Input
2 Outputs
- 75faab102aaa4e6f77ac3f9840d8684fd08c003a85e52ac999a9f34230f2b0db:0
- 75faab102aaa4e6f77ac3f9840d8684fd08c003a85e52ac999a9f34230f2b0db:1
value 2308
address 1DUPAZ52ueXcPhnxbskKdkfPqf6tYkwHiZ
value 567098
address 1FNkvxGDLPTNbX6XsrBfmZeYQ7vs57zGD6